The foreskin can get an overgrowth of yeast which can cause the symptoms you are describing. An antifungal/antiyeast cream such as Nizoral (ketoconazole) 2% cream, or miconazole, or clotrimazole may treat it.
I am hesitant for you to use an over the counter anti-yeast cream without your rash being diagnosed in person to determine if it is a yeast infection (rather than something else), and the extent of the swelling and constriction. You can try the anti-yeast cream I mentioned, but it doesn't work right away (it can take a few days). If your symptoms get worse in the meantime (more swelling or constriction), then do go in to see a doctor promptly. I say this because excessive swelling can prevent retraction and then make urination difficult, and also cause splitting of the foreskin and set it up for a bacterial infection.
